Just Water has moved its Head Office and Bottling Plant to new premises in Hugo Johnston Drive. Having purchased the building in September 2015, and they gutted the premises, building a state-of-the-art building and bottling plant. “It has taken a year to get the full resource consents and building consent to get the job done,” said Tony Falkenstein, Chief Executive of Just Water International Ltd, “but the results are outstanding”.

 

The new office is open plan, with a large recreational facility and separate meeting rooms and massage room on the first floor, and a masseuse comes into the offices twice a week to massage out the aches and pains of Just Water’s team who are sitting at a computer all day. A 75-inch TV screen comes out from the wall, and is used for training, as well as watching important sports games!

 

Just Water is well known as a progressive ‘people’ company, and at Just Water gender is not an issue, with over half the management team being female. “We tend to talk about ‘diversity’ in terms of age and race”, said Tony Falkenstein. “We have been poor here, but recently hired 26 year old Katie Hirst to the senior management team, and are putting emphasis on young people to become leaders within the Company”.

 

To this end, last month Tony took two ‘under-25’s’ to Shanghai to work at a Trade Show the company attended there, and every three months, Just Water has a ‘Breakfast Club’ for the ‘under-30’s’, where they get together with the CEO and COO to tell them how the Company could perform better. Tony has always been at the forefront of looking after his team and the fabulous new premises gave him more opportunities to continue in this vein.
